John Quincy Adams raised silkworms, and his wife spun the silk. The tale of keeping an alligator in the East Room is probably apocryphal. Martin van Buren may or may not have received two lions or two tiger cubs from the emperor of Morocco. The gift did include two horses. James Buchanan had dogs and…

The global pet food industry is projected to grow from $128 billion in 2024 to $185 billion by 2030, driven largely by premiumization and digital transformation, according to a white paper Ask Mona just released. The report examines how pet food brands can use QR codes combined with conversational artificial intelligence to create interactive packaging…
